With demand soaring for the next big one-design keelboat class, the New York Yacht Club and Melges Performance Sailboats have licensed a second manufacturer for the IC37 by Melges.
Launched just a week ago, the first IC37 by Melges has aced its initial sea trials on Narragansett Bay and, in the process, added significant energy to the already substantial buzz surrounding what many in the sport believe will be the next great one-design keelboat.
Westerly Marine has finished building the New York Yacht Club’s first IC37 by Melges. The boat departed Southern California on Friday, headed to Rhode Island for sea trials.The strong collaboration of talent involved in this project will sail the boat for the first time off Newport, R.I., later this month.

The Canada’s Cup Committee has selected the Melges IC37 Class as the platform for their new vision for the event.
To create the next great one-design class, the New York Yacht Club has partnered with Melges along with other industry leaders, including Mills Design, North Sails and Westerly Marine.
